Original Description
August Macke's Blumentopf (Flowerpot) radiates with vibrant color and playful energy, embodying the essence of German Expressionism and the painter’s fascination with light and form. Created in 1910, Macke’s work blends elements of Post-Impressionism and early Fauvism, showcasing his bold use of saturated hues and simplified shapes to convey joy and spontaneity. The painting depicts a curvaceous pot brimming with lush flowers, rendered in warm reds, deep blues, and lush greens—colors that seem to hum with life. A key figure in Der Blaue Reiter (The Blue Rider) movement, Macke sought to express emotional depth through abstraction, though his work remained more lyrical than his contemporaries like Kandinsky. Tragically, Macke’s career was cut short during WWI, making Blumentopf a precious glimpse into his evolving style. Today, it symbolizes the bridge between representational art and modernist experimentation, celebrated for its harmony and optimism.
